Handover note — Twistlock rotation utility

Hey, welcome aboard! I'm passing you Twistlock, our little internal tool that rotates service secrets on a schedule. It mostly runs itself, but twice a month the rotation job needs a nudge if the staging cluster is slow. New folks: don't panic when it logs "stale lease," that's cosmetic. The one thing that actually matters is the master unseal — if the rotation keystore ever locks itself, you recover it with the passphrase that appears right below this note.

vault phrase of yagag-kadup = belael-druius-rusax-kelox

**Ticket TURN-882: Gate C turnstile counter double-counting**

The Larkfield Arena turnstile counter is double-counting on Gate C whenever the sensor rebounds. Numbers from Saturday's match were ~8% high. Probably the debounce window got shortened in the Spinnaker firmware update. Flagging for the weekly sync — can someone confirm which build Gate C is running? Trace token for the suspect firmware follows.

trace token, fafog-kageg: htk4_98e6

Crash payloads from plugins built against the Lorecast SDK flow through the Mavenholt intake queue before symbolication. If your plugin's reports show as "unmapped" in the Dashview console, confirm you uploaded debug symbols for the exact version users are running; partial uploads are silently rejected. Symbol processing takes up to 20 minutes. Retries beyond three attempts require the intake queue to be drained by the Pipeline team. When filing a support ticket, always quote the reference shown below.

session token of hawif-bajog = htk6_9ab8da

# Break-Glass: Catalog Cache Invalidation

Scope: the Pinrow product catalog at Veldstone Retail. If stale prices persist after a purge and the Hollowmere invalidation queue is wedged, use break-glass to flush the edge tier directly. Contractors: get verbal sign-off from the catalog lead first. Steps: open the Hollowmere admin shell, select emergency-flush, confirm the tenant, and run it once — repeated flushes thrash the origin. Access is logged and expires after 20 minutes. Unseal the admin shell with the passphrase below.

recovery phrase for kahop-tajog: istix-casvan